Jordan Nwora of Crvena Zvezda Meridianbet Belgrade delivered an all-around career-best performance to earn EuroLeague Round 4 MVP honors. Nwora led Zvezda to an 88-79 win over previously unbeaten Zalgiris Kaunas with 24 points (7/12 two-pointers, 1/4 three-pointers, 7/8 free throws), 7 rebounds, 5 steals, 3 assists, and 2 blocks, finishing with a personal-high PIR of 34.

Panathinaikos Athens center Richaun Holmes posted the second-highest PIR of 33 in a 91-85 win over LDLC ASVEL Villeurbanne, scoring 24 points on 11/12 two-point shooting with 10 rebounds and 1 block. Nadir Hifi of Paris Basketball followed with a PIR of 32 in a 105-87 victory over Baskonia Vitoria-Gasteiz, recording career highs of 29 points, 5 assists, and 4 steals.

Mfiondu Kabengele of Dubai Basketball added 26 points and 7 rebounds for a 31 PIR in a 93-69 road win over Fenerbahce Beko Istanbul. Other top performers included Panathinaikos Athens guard Kendrick Nunn (26 points, 6 assists, 5 rebounds) and Hapoel IBI Tel Aviv guard Vasilije Micic (24 points, 6 assists, 2 steals).

Individual highs:

Points: Nadir Hifi, Paris Basketball – 29 points; leads the league with 23.3 ppg.

Rebounds: Devin Booker, EA7 Emporio Armani Milan – 12; Derek Willis, Paris Basketball – 12; Sasha Vezenkov, Olympiacos Piraeus – league leader, 10.0 rpg.

Assists: Chris Jones, Hapoel IBI Tel Aviv – 8; Toko Shengelia, FC Barcelona – 8; Darius Thompson, Valencia Basket – 8; season leaders: Wade Baldwin (Fenerbahce), Sylvain Francisco (Zalgiris) – 6.8 apg.

Steals: Jordan Nwora – 5; season leader: Nadir Hifi – 3.3 spg.

Blocks: Twelve players with 2 blocks; league leader: Walter Tavares, Real Madrid – 1.8 bpg.

Double-doubles in Round 4: Richaun Holmes – 24 points, 10 rebounds; Devin Booker – 11 points, 12 rebounds.
